On the 17th (local time), according to breaking economic news channel Walter Bloomberg, 9 of the 19 members of the U.S. Federal Reserve (Fed) expected interest rates to be cut twice more this year.
Along with this, 2 said they expected one cut, and 6 said there would be no additional cuts. The remaining officials did not state specific positions.
